Angular contact ball bearing, have grooves inside their inner and outer rings that form a certain angle to each other. This property makes them suitable for carrying axial and radial loads continuously. A row of angular contact beams can carry axial loads only in one direction.

Types of Angular contact ball bearing

In general, angular contact ball bearing can be divided into two categories:

1. The contact ball bearing are angled in a row.

These types of bearings have a contact angle of 40 degrees that do not separate and can work at high speeds as needed. These bearings are available in two ways that are suitable for different arrangements. Normal type for use They are used individually and that is in cases where the axial force is applied to the bearing from only one side. The joint type is used when two or more pairs of bearings must be used together in different ways. In this type Bearings that have a single row of balls and are produced for the purpose of using two can be adjusted in any way to each other in a double mode so that they have positive or negative slack or the same load distribution in this type. Bearings do not need to use filler gaskets.

The dual-use method is chosen when the load bearing of a single-row belay is insufficient alone or when force enters the belay from two directions.

2. The ball bearing are two rows of angular contacts.

The A-type long-range angular contact ball bearings are the newest type of this family. Their internal design dimensions have been optimized. Their contact angle is 32 degrees and they lack a sinkhole. Another type of two-row ball bearings have a sinkhole on one side but have been gradually replaced by the A-type.

The sealed bowl types are filled by a type of lithium-based grease that has good anti-corrosion properties and can operate in the temperature range of 30- to 110+ degrees Celsius.

A: The internal design of the bearing is optimized
B: 40 degree contact angle
B+CB+M: BCBM
B+E+CB+M :BECBM
B+E+CB+P: BECBP
B+E+M: BEM
B+E+P: BEP
B+G+M: BGM
B+M: BM
C2: Bearing radial slack less than normal
C3: Bearing radial slack more than normal
CA: Bearings for general use with less than normal axial clearance
CB: Bearings for general use with normal axial clearance
CC: Bearings for general use with more axial clearance than normal
E: Optimized internal bearing design
F: Steel bearing rack material
G: Larger general purpose bearings with normal axial clearance
GA: Bearings for general use with low initial load
GB: Bearings for general use with medium initial load
GC: Bearings for general use with high initial load
M: Brass bearing rack
P: Fiber bearing rack
P6: Increasing accuracy in the dimensions and rotation of the bearing
2RS1: The bearing has a reinforced felt cup on both sides
ZZ: The bearing has a reinforced metal washer on both sides
